Boswellia Serrata Resin Extract is an east indian tree that yields a resin used medicinally and is also burned as incense. Boswellia is used as a herbal medicine for many inflammatory diseases, including an alternative treatment for osteoarthritis. Boswellia’s efficacy is considered to be quite high, when compared to NSAIDs and Cox-2 Inhibitors (Advil, Aleve, Celebrex,etc), without all the dangerous side effects.
Therapeutic effects on osteoarthritis:
- decrease in joint pain
- increased range-of-motion
- increased stamina during physical activity
- increased flexibility and mobility
- decrease in swelling
Side effects?
No major side effects have been mentioned in medical journals. Occasionally patients have reported a slight stomach upset. Therefore, we suggest taking Boswellia supplements with meals.
